Impact of gold and silver nanoparticles in highly viscous flows with different body forces

Аннотация

The present investigation is relevant to the multiphase flow of non-Newtonian fluid passing through the steep channel. Third-grade fluid is taken as the base liquid, while two different types of metallic particles are considered to form nano-suspensions. Two different plane flows are devised based on the development of rigid walls of the inclined channels. A comprehensive apprehension regarding the nonlinear flow dynamics is carried out with the help of a regular perturbation method, which is effectively less time-consuming and more analogous to analytic. Moreover, a comparative analysis depicts complete harmony with the existing literature. In addition, the current study reduces back to the customary nanofluid problem for the limiting case.
